Magnet - Mondrian Size_Paper_XS_250_176 The prints of Utamaro (1753–1806)Composition II in Red, Blue, and Yellow by Piet Mondrian This well known work of art by Dutch painter Piet Mondrian is a product of the Dutch De Stijl movement. Mondrian decides to limit his formal vocabulary to the three primary colors (red, blue and yellow), the three primary values (black, white and gray) and the two primary directions (horizontal and vertical).
